Co-founders Phil Smoley and Zane Jensen will present events that happened 150 years ago as part of the ongoing commemoration of the sesquicentennial of the Civil War.
In addition, there will be a brief review of the the first 12 meetings that covered month by month the events of 1861.
This meeting will mark the first anniversary of the group, and a small celebration is planned after the presentations.
In its first year, the meetings have attracted groups as small as 16 and as large as 32.
“These folks really love their history,” said Smoley. “Most everyone has a unique perspective or historic family narrative that makes the group dynamic and exciting. Everyone has learned something from most every attendee.”
The monthly meetings attempt to follow the Civil War month by month, and will have one or two presenters followed by a roundtable discussion.
“The discussions have been robust. In many ways, we are still dealing with unresolved issues left over from that period,” Smoley said.
